Improper Privilege Management

Abstraction: Class · Status: Draft

The product does not properly assign, modify, track, or check privileges for an actor, creating an unintended sphere of control for that actor.

An issue was discovered in the Hyundai Gen5W_L in-vehicle infotainment system AE_E_PE_EUR.S5W_L001.001.211214. The AppUpgrade binary file, which is used during the firmware installation process, can be modified by an attacker to bypass the digital signature check. This indirectly allows an attacker to install custom firmware in the IVI system.

The Spectra Pro plugin for WordPress is vulnerable to privilege escalation in all versions up to, and including, 1.1.5. This is due to the plugin allowing lower-privileged users to create registration forms and set the default role to administrator This makes it possible for authenticated attackers, with author-level access and above, to create administrator-level accounts.

Mitigation MIT-1
Architecture and Design Operation

Very carefully manage the setting, management, and handling of privileges. Explicitly manage trust zones in the software.

Mitigation MIT-48
Architecture and Design

Strategy: Separation of Privilege

Follow the principle of least privilege when assigning access rights to entities in a software system.

Mitigation MIT-49
Architecture and Design

Strategy: Separation of Privilege

Consider following the principle of separation of privilege. Require multiple conditions to be met before permitting access to a system resource.

CAPEC-122: Privilege Abuse

An adversary is able to exploit features of the target that should be reserved for privileged users or administrators but are exposed to use by lower or non-privileged accounts. Access to sensitive information and functionality must be controlled to ensure that only authorized users are able to access these resources.

CAPEC-233: Privilege Escalation

An adversary exploits a weakness enabling them to elevate their privilege and perform an action that they are not supposed to be authorized to perform.

CAPEC-58: Restful Privilege Elevation

An adversary identifies a Rest HTTP (Get, Put, Delete) style permission method allowing them to perform various malicious actions upon server data due to lack of access control mechanisms implemented within the application service accepting HTTP messages.
